Are you looking for a memorable experience that gives you a taste of majestic Norwegian fjord landscapes and insight into life along the fjord?

On this RIB tour to the Hardanger Bridge and into the Osafjord, you will experience roadless fjord villages and spectacular scenery. 


From Ulvik, the boat trip goes to the impressive Hardanger Bridge, the longest suspension bridge in Norway, and then from the main fjord, we drive into the 13 km long and beautiful fjord arm Osafjorden, where we pass several old, roadless fjord villages. Here, you will be taken back in time, and you will gain insight into the lives of the people who lived here along the fjord. 

We stop several times along the fjord to give you time to enjoy the fjord landscape and let all the impressions sink in. The guide will provide you with interesting and thought-provoking facts about the fjord and the people who have lived their lives here for generations. 

Along the way, you will safely experience the power of our RIB (Rigid Inflatable Boat) which gives you wind in your hair and adrenaline in your blood.
